Regional Context for Integrated Refineries
Southeast Asia's petrochemical landscape benefits from strategic locations that facilitate access to abundant crude oil reserves and proximity to major export markets. In Brunei Darussalam, for instance, developments on Pulau Muara Besar leverage the island's logistical advantages, including deep-water ports and established industrial zones. Such sites enable efficient handling of high-volume operations, with total processing capacities reaching up to 20 million tons annually across multiple phases.
Historical precedents show that initial phases, such as those completed in late 2019 with an 8 million tons per year crude throughput and a $3.45 billion investment, set the foundation for subsequent expansions. These early stages demonstrate the viability of joint ventures in creating robust facilities that produce a mix of fuels and chemicals, contributing to local economic diversification beyond traditional oil exports. Scaling Production Capabilities
Modern refinery expansions prioritize optimized designs that incorporate advanced technologies for higher yields of premium products. A typical second-phase project might target an additional 12 million tons per year in processing capacity, focusing on outputs like diesel, paraxylene (PX), benzene, polypropylene, and other refined oils with elevated market value. This scaling not only doubles overall site capabilities but also introduces efficiencies in energy use and waste management, essential for long-term viability.
By securing necessary approvals, including tax incentives from host governments and financing commitments from financial institutions and shareholders, these projects ensure funding alignment with construction timelines. Commitments such as loan intentions from entities like the Brunei Islamic Bank and equity pledges from partners underscore the collaborative nature of these endeavors. Aiming for operational readiness by the end of 2028, such timelines reflect careful planning to integrate new units seamlessly with existing operations, minimizing downtime and maximizing throughput from the outset.
